How Is A Blower Door Test Conducted?
When blower door test in Nutley, NJ is conducted, every exterior door and window is closed, and interior doors are left open to achieve uniform air movement inside. A central exterior door is picked, where the technician fits an adjustable aluminum frame and fabric panel for airtight testing. A precisely calibrated fan is installed on the frame to reduce the air pressure inside to 50 Pascals, equal to a steady 20 mph wind outdoors.
When indoor air is extracted, outdoor air pushes in through every leak and small gap in the building. A nanometer is used to detect and compare the pressure created by the fan with the air pressure inside the structure. From these readings, the number of air changes per hour (ACH) is determined, revealing the home’s airtightness and performance efficiency in NJ.
What Is A Passing Blower Door Test Score?
In Nutley, NJ, residential buildings must meet the benchmarks set by the 2015 International Energy Conservation Code (IECC) or any newer codes adopted locally. In most areas, an acceptable blower door test result is 3 air changes per hour or less, confirming that the home achieves optimal energy efficiency. Meeting this level during your blower door test in Nutley, NJ supports energy efficiency and verifies that your home meets local codes.
Why Do I Need A Blower Door Test?
The State of NJ and local municipalities have implemented the IECC code, which mandates blower door test on new and remodeled residential homes. We often collaborate with home builders, contractors, and homeowners who require blower door test in Nutley, NJ to meet energy efficiency standards and close permits. A duct leakage test might be required when HVAC units or ductwork are installed beyond the home’s thermal envelope. Learn more about energy code compliance.
By performing blower door test in Nutley, NJ, homeowners can identify where conditioned air escapes. Depressurization makes leaks visible, uncovering ways to enhance comfort and efficiency. It only takes a few hours to perform a blower door test, but the long-lasting impact on comfort and efficiency is felt through NJ’ hot summers and cool winters.
How To Pass A Blower Door Test:
- Anticipate potential air leaks before testing begins.
- Use materials like Tyvek or Zip Sheathing as your air barrier and ensure every seam is well taped for best results.
- Install insulation of the appropriate R-value and inspect to confirm it’s correctly fitted in all envelope areas.
- Seal all penetrations in exterior walls using caulk or spray foam.
- Ensure doors and windows are properly installed, caulked, and weather-sealed.
- Eliminate air leaks by sealing all openings between conditioned areas and unconditioned spaces, including basements and attics.
